FDM is a global business and technology consultancy seeking a Blue Prism Software Developer to work for our client within the public sector. This is initially a 3-month contract with the potential to extend. This role will be remote with an expectation that the successful candidates visits the Blackpool, Gosport or Bristol office once or twice per month.
As a Blue Prism Developer, you will join tour clients dynamic team and will be responsible for designing, developing, testing, and deploying Blue Prism processes to automate business operations. The role requires close collaboration with business analysts, IT teams, and process owners to ensure successful automation delivery and ongoing process optimisation.
Responsibilities
- Develop automated processes adhering to DBS AG standard design principles
- Configure new processes efficiently and maintain clear documentation
- Support and modify existing processes within change control guidelines
- Troubleshoot and resolve issues in processes promptly
- Adhere to project plans, communicate risks and contribute to change control
- Assist operational teams during user acceptance testing (UAT) and roll-out phases
- Create and document test procedures for pre-UAT phases
Requirements
- Strong written communication skills to articulate business processes and automated solution designs clearly
- Demonstrable experience developing and configuring automation solutions in Blue Prism
- Ability to conceptualise and grasp automation tools and solutions
- Proficient in workflow logic, including interpreting workflow diagrams and translating written processes into visual representations
- Competent in end user computing, particularly in intermediate spreadsheet usage or equivalent
- Familiar with formal change control procedures and protocols
- Understand AGILE delivery methodology
- Candidate must have live SC Clearance or be eligible for SC clearance
